Carlyle-backed Viyash Scientific has bought Italy’s BioForLife for Rs. 188 crore, according to an official release.BioforLife, based in Milan, Italy, specializes in the development, commercialization and distribution of pet care products.The acquisition is expected to close in the second quarter of financial year 2026-27.Viyash Scientific said BioForLife reaches over 80% of all veterinary clinics in Italy, thereby providing well-established customer relationships for future growth."This acquisition represents another important step in our strategy to build a leading global Companion Animal Health business. BioForLife provides us with an established platform in Italy, one of Europe's most attractive pet care markets, while strengthening our presence across the region,” said Haribabu Bodepudi, Viyash Scientific’s managing director and group chief executive officer.The acquisition is being made through Alvira Animal Health, a wholly owned subsidiary of Viyash Scientific.Viyash Scientific is looking to ‘capitalize on the mega-trend’ of a growing companion animal health generics market through this acquisition, the company said in its release.
